An Implantable System For Chronic In Vivo Electromyography
Published on: April 21, 2020
P R Troyk1, G A DeMichele, D A Kerns
1Biomedical Engineering Department, Illinois Institute of Technology, Chicago, IL 60616, USA.
Researchers improved an implantable myoelectric sensor (IMES) system for upper-extremity prosthesis control. Enhancements focus on improved functionality, and protection against electrical malfunction and tissue damage for human implantation.
